I have a bluetooth mouse and touchpad.

Mouse is hard to control, because it is very fast. When I reducing a pointer acceleration, mouse speed becomes normal, but touchpad becomes insensitive.

Is it a way to set mouse and touchpad sensivity separately?

Setting a MaxSpeed, MinSpeed and AccelFactor for touchpad in xorg.conf change nothing, setting Sensitivity in InputDevice section for Bluetooth Mouse change nothing too.

You may be able to use the "synclient" utility to adjust these settings.

Sensivity for touchpad is changing, but mouse is still too fast even i set a pointer acceleration in "System settings" to it's minumum value - 0,1x.

Is it a way to decrease mouse sensivity?
